Application effect of general anesthesia combined with brachial plexus block anesthesia in patients undergoing shoulder arthroscopic surgery
Objective:To explore the application effect of general anesthesia combined with brachial plexus block anesthesia in patients undergoing shoulder arthroscopic surgery.Methods:The clinical data of 80 patients who underwent shoulder arthroscopy in our hospital from May 2022 to December 2023 were collected.The patients were divided into a control group(n=39)and an observation group(n=41)based on the difference in anesthesia schemes,with general anesthesia for the control group and brachial plexus block combined with general anesthesia for the observation group.After the patient completes the surgery,observe its anesthesia effect and assess the pain level by the oral description of the Visual analogue scale(VAS).During the perioperative period,use an electrocardiogram monitor to detect hemodynamic changes and statistically analyze adverse reactions that occurred during this period.Results:The observation group exhibited a significantly shorter postoperative recovery time and extubation time compared to the control group(P<0.05).Compared with the pre-operative period,systolic blood pressure(SBP),diastolic blood pressure(DBP),heart rate,and VAS score in all treatment groups decreased(P<0.05).The decrease was more significant in the observation group(P<0.05).The total incidence of adverse reactions in the observation group was significantly lower than in the control group(P<0.05).Conclusion:General anesthesia combined with brachial plexus block in shoulder arthroscopy surgery improves the anesthetic and analgesic effects,improves hemodynamics,and reduces adverse reactions.
